New data from HM Revenue & Customs (HMRC) has revealed inheritance tax (IHT) receipts are £0.9 billion higher than in the same period a … WebJan 18, 2024 · Inheritance tax (IHT) is usually levied on the value of all the assets in an individual’s estate on death, after deducting any liabilities, exemptions and reliefs. Assets left to a spouse or civil partner of the deceased are usually exempt, as are assets left to a charity. As of 2024, the six states that charge an inheritance tax are: … 24 snap feathers WebNov 29, 2024 · Inheritance Tax is a tax on an estate (the property, money and possessions) of someone who's died. There's normally no Inheritance Tax to pay if: the value of the estate is below the threshold. the estate is left to a spouse or civil partner, a charity or a community amateur sports club.
